A Louisiana real estate licensee may advertise their services under which name?
AAny name they choose regardless of their licensed name
BOnly their legal name as it appears on their license or their brokerage's licensed name✓ Correct
CA team name without disclosing brokerage affiliation
DOnly their broker's name
Explanation
Louisiana licensees must advertise under their licensed name and must disclose their brokerage affiliation. Using a team name without proper brokerage disclosure or advertising under an unlicensed name is prohibited.
